#0d2c23 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0d2c23 is composed of 5.1% red, 17.3% green and 13.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 70.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 20.5% yellow and 82.7% black. It has a hue angle of 162.6 degrees, a saturation of 54.4% and a lightness of 11.2%. #0d2c23 color hex could be obtained by blending #1a5846 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003333.

Shades and Tints of #0d2c23
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040e0b is the darkest color, while #fefff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#0d2c23
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#1c1d1d is the less saturated color, while #023728 is the most saturated one.
